Whispers of the Destined Love
The moon hung low in the sky, casting an ethereal glow over the ancient forest. In the heart of this mystical woodland, two figures stood, their eyes reflecting the moonlight. One was a knight, his armor gleaming with the promise of valor and honor, yet his heart yearned for something beyond the call of duty. The other was a sorcerer, cloaked in shadows, his power a whispered secret known only to him and the stars above.
Thorn, the knight, had been chosen by destiny to wield the Saddle of Destiny, a magical artifact that could alter the very fabric of reality. Yet, as he rode through the world, he felt a void within him that no battle or victory could fill. His gaze often drifted to the sorcerer, Lyre, who seemed to hold the key to his inner turmoil.
"Lyre," Thorn's voice was a mere whisper, "do you feel it too? The pull, the... longing?"
Lyre looked up, his eyes meeting Thorn's with a depth that seemed to transcend the physical world. "Yes, Thorn. It's not just a pull, it's a call. A call to something beyond our understanding."
The two had met by chance, during a fierce battle that Lyre had seemingly orchestrated to test Thorn's worth. Yet, in the aftermath, they found themselves drawn to each other, their connection as inexplicable as it was undeniable.
"Tell me, Lyre," Thorn continued, his voice barely above a murmur, "what is this bond we share? Why does it feel as if we've been separated by time and space, yet connected by something far more powerful?"
Lyre stepped closer, his presence a gentle warmth in the cool night air. "It is a bond of destiny, Thorn. We are two halves of a whole, separated by fate yet united by love. The Saddle of Destiny is not just a tool of power, it is a vessel for our shared destiny."
Thorn's heart raced with a mix of fear and excitement. "But what does this mean for us? For our... love?"
Lyre's smile was soft, filled with a sense of peace that seemed to emanate from him. "It means that our love is not just a fleeting emotion, but a force of nature itself. It is a love that defies all boundaries, a love that will lead us to our true purpose."
As the night wore on, the two shared stories of their lives, their hearts beating in sync with the rhythm of the forest. They spoke of their pasts, of the trials and tribulations that had brought them to this moment, and of the future that lay before them.
But the future was not without peril. The Saddle of Destiny was a powerful artifact, and many sought to possess it for their own gain. Among them was a dark sorcerer named Malakar, who would stop at nothing to claim the saddle and bend it to his will.
Thorn and Lyre knew that their love was not just a secret they must keep from the world, but a battle they must fight against the forces that sought to destroy them. They had to find a way to harness the full power of the saddle, a power that could change the course of their destiny and the fate of the world.
Their quest took them to the farthest reaches of the known world, through treacherous deserts, into the depths of enchanted forests, and into the heart of ancient ruins. Along the way, they encountered allies and enemies, each testing their resolve and their love.
In a final confrontation with Malakar, Thorn and Lyre stood together, their bond as strong as the magic that flowed through them. With the Saddle of Destiny at their side, they fought with all their might, their love fueling their strength and their will.
As the dust settled and the battle ended, Thorn and Lyre found themselves standing in the ruins, the saddle now a glowing beacon of hope and power. They looked at each other, their eyes filled with a love that had withstood the test of time and the forces of darkness.
"Lyre," Thorn said, his voice filled with a newfound confidence, "we have done it. We have found our place in the stars."
Lyre smiled, his eyes twinkling with joy. "Indeed, Thorn. And together, we will continue to shine, forever bound by love and destiny."
The two embraced, their love now a force that could not be contained, a love that would forever change the world. And as they stood together, under the watchful gaze of the moon, they knew that their journey was just beginning, and that their love was a force that could overcome any obstacle, any challenge.
In the end, it was not just the Saddle of Destiny that had been claimed, but the love between Thorn and Lyre, a love that would forever transcend the boundaries of time and space, a love that was truly destined to last forever.
